In this episode of St.Aub, we reflect on the endurance required for the Godward life. In a culture shaped by quick results and instant gratification, the spiritual journey often unfolds much more slowly. Growth, healing, and transformation happen over years of faithful obedience, trust, and perseverance.
Drawing from Scripture, the wisdom of the saints, and the example of those who have endured suffering with faith, St.Aub explores what it means to pursue a “long obedience in the same direction.” The Godward path is not a sprint but a marathon. It's one that will inevitably include hardship, disappointment, doubt, and seasons when faith is tested.
This episode invites you to consider how trials can deepen rather than destroy faith. Throughout Scripture, we see that spiritual maturity is often forged through patient endurance. Even when the path feels difficult, God remains faithful, guiding us toward a deeper trust in His presence and promises.
